Biography
Paul Wesley, born Paul Thomas Wasilewski, is a multi-talented American actor, writer, director, and producer. Beyond his impressive acting skills, Wesley is also fluent in Polish, a language he picked up during his formative years spent in Poland.
His career took off with his television debut on NBC's soap opera, Another World, where he portrayed the character of 'Sean McKinnon'. Following this, Wesley's talent landed him a main role in the CBS series Wolf Lake, showcasing his versatility as an actor in the role of Luke Cates.
Wesley's television credits are extensive, including appearances in popular shows like 24, The O.C., and Smallville. However, he truly made a mark with his iconic portrayal of Stefan Salvatore in the supernatural drama series The Vampire Diaries, solidifying his status as a fan-favorite in the industry.
In addition to his television success, Wesley has also graced the big screen with his presence, appearing in various films such as The Russell Girl and the ABC Family miniseries Fallen. His ability to seamlessly transition between television and film roles speaks volumes about his range and dedication to his craft.
One of Wesley's notable roles outside of The Vampire Diaries was his portrayal of James T. Kirk in the Paramount+ original series Star Trek: Strange New Worlds, showcasing his ability to take on diverse and complex characters with ease.
